Denise,

You say that this mom was overweight, struggled to get pregnant, had
gestational diabetes and minimal breast changes?

Has she ever been diagnosed PCOS?  Was she oligomenorrheic, and has she
struggled at all with hirsutism (you have to ask, because they usually wax)?
If the answer to any of these is yes, look up some of my posts on PCOS in
the archives, and then let's talk! I'm researching this area and have some
ideas that could be pursued.

To anyone else working with milk supply & PCOS cases, I'd love to know more
about your cases, too, for my research.
